Virtual Human Platform
The Virtual Human Platform (VHP) was developed through the VHP4Safety project to support chemical and pharmaceutical safety testing. VHP provides you with human-relevant tools and models for precision safety evaluation, helping you reduce reliance on laboratory animals.

GMGPolar
GMGPolar is a geometric multigrid solver using implicit extrapolation to raise the convergence order. It is based on meshes in tensor- or product-format. GMGPolar's focus applications are geometries that can be described by polar or curvilinear coordinates for which suited smoothing is available.
